@Dbag26, dimensional shield is easy cheese but there are so many ways to get past that if you're having problems with it your deck has a hole in it. Momentum (buff or intrinsic), spell damage, any kind of permanent control, quanta denial/pillar destruction because that card's expensive, powerful shields of your own, sundials to keep creatures at bay and get a draw if you have light quanta, or even wait it out while keeping yourself healed.
